LEHMAN LICENSE


37 Pa. D. & C. 2d 295 (1965)

Lehman License

Common Pleas Court of Delaware County, Pennsylvania.

October 19, 1965.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

George R. Johnson, for appellants.

James J. Phelan, Jr., Special Assistant Attorney General, for Liquor Control Board.


SWENEY, P. J., October 19, 1965.

This matter is before the court en banc upon the motion of the Pennsylvania Liquor Control Board to quash the appeal because it was filed eight days after the statutory period.
